Accepted Paper:

Functionality, accessibility and communicativeness as essential specifics of ethnographic film in SEM  
Nadja Valentincic Furlan (Slovene Ethnographic Museum)

Paper short abstract:

Three essential specifics of ethnographic film in the Slovene Ethnographic Museum are: it is integrated into exhibitions; ethnographic films and audiovisuals, data and reflections on them are accessible to visitors in various manners; audiovisuals serve as a medium for communication with museum visitors, inviting them to take an active part.

Paper long abstract:

Professional activities of the Department of Ethnographic Film (established in 2000) in The Slovene Ethnographic Museum in Ljubljana, Slovenia, has three essential specifics. Recently it has been orientated into production of visual ethnographic contents for the permanent exhibition of SEM, where several parameters are considered: the concept of the exhibition, the exhibition's author' guidance, references of ethnographic film and the medium itself, audience, and user friendly integration of the media in the exhibition. The second characteristic of the ethnographic film and audiovisual media in SEM is accessibility to the visitors at the exhibitions, at film presentations, as a part of workshops, and through a review of Slovene ethnographic films Ethnovideo Marathon, which transformed into an international festival Days of Ethnographic Film in 2007. The Department supports the accessibility of the audiovisuals, as well as of data and reflections on them with DVD publications, on the web page of the Museum, with lectures in the museum and outside it, and with participation at the conferences and festivals. The third challenge is to establish the two way communication with the visitors at the exhibition. This can be achieved at several levels: at the level of the contents of audiovisuals, with the mode of screening and accessing them, at the level of encouraging (self)reflection of the visitors, and finally, by inviting the visitors to active participation.
